android - Appium 创建 session 失败

我正在关注这个 Appium 教程:https://youtu.be/i1tQ1pjEFWw我的 Appium 无法启动 session 。这是我从检查员那里得到的错误:

无法创建 session 。找不到请求的资源,或者使用映射资源不支持的 HTTP 方法接收到请求

这是我使用的 JSON 表示形式:

{
  "appium:deviceName": "emulator-5554",
  "platformName": "android",
  "appium:appPackage": "com.android.calculator2",
  "appium:appActivity": ".Calculator",
  "appium:noReset": true
}

这是 Appium 上显示的错误:

[HTTP] No route found for /session
[HTTP] <-- POST /session 404 14 ms - 211

我的模拟器工作正常,它显示在 adb 设备上。我正在使用来自 Android Studio 的 Pixel 2 API 28 模拟器。

Screenshot

最佳答案

Important migration information from Appiun-Inspector

重要迁移说明

此版本的 Appium Inspector 设计为默认与 Appium 2.0 一起使用。因此,如果您要从 Appium Desktop(设计为默认使用 Appium 1.x)迁移,您需要了解一些变化:

默认远程服务器路径已从/wd/hub 更改为/以反射(reflect) Appium 2.0 的默认服务器路径。如果您将 Appium Inspector 与 Appium 1.x 服务器一起使用,您可能需要将新 session 表单中的路径信息更新回/wd/hub。

https://stackoverflow.com/questions/70549041/

相关文章:

javascript - 3 条件 - 三元条件链 JavaScript react

javascript - 如何在 react 中更改 useState 的对象值?

julia - 如何在 Julia 中绘制复数?

python - 绕过欧盟同意请求

r - 从向量中提取字符元素

haskell - haskell 中有包含字符串和列表的类型吗?

rust - 错误处理、map_err 和错误类型转换

python - Julia 重新编码未定义

powershell - 对 Powershell 脚本中的所有错误调用函数

firebase - argumnet 类型 'Null Funcion(DataSnapshot)